PHP开发中的错误收集,不定期更新。


Posted in PHP onFebruary 03, 2011

Fatal error: Non-static method Conn::__construct() cannot be called statically in /file.php

没有静态的方法(里面这个指方法参数,字符串类型),不能从静态上下文引用。

Fatal error: [] operator not supported for strings in /file.php

当一个变量已设为非数组类型的时候,就不能再次使用[]让同名变量增加数据键值
解决方法:1.改变变量名称、2.使用$var = array(...)
举例:

//这里为字符串类型 
$err = $e->getMessage(); //当执行到这里的时候会报错 
$err[] = array 
( 
'gid' => $this->_get['id'], 
'url' => $new, 
'log' => $err, 
'time' => time() 
);

Fatal error: Declaration of Listing::content() must be compatible with that of InewsList::content() in file\List_1.php on line 7

统一接口所有类方法都必须和接口规定的一致:作用域声明、方法名、参数数量

Warning: mysqli::query() [mysqli.query]: Couldn't fetch Insert in /file.php

必须使用mysqli链接数据库后返回的结果集去执行操作。

Warning: 1064_You have an error in your SQL syntax; check the manual that corresponds to your MySQL server version for the right syntax to use near...

网上搜索是MYSQL兼容问题,实际操作上是语法错误,需检查SQL语句写的是否正确。

Warning: array_shift() expects parameter 1 to be array, integer given

函数第一个参数必须是一个数组。

#1366 - Incorrect integer value: '' for column 'ID' at row 1

mysql版本为msyql 5.1.14 WIN32版本,出现错误的原因是没有给自增ID赋值,尽管之前的版本可以不赋值,自动增加,但是在新版本的msyql中需要为其赋值NULL

#1136:Column count doesn't match value count at row 1

检查一下有没有序号自增加的字段。
所存储的数据与数据库表的字段类型定义不相匹配.
字段类型是否正确, 是否越界, 有无把一种类型的数据存储到另一种数据类型中.

#1062_Duplicate entry '...' for key 'map'

关键字重复、可能是主键ID、也可能是唯一字段。

PHP 相关文章推荐
一个连接两个不同MYSQL数据库的PHP程序
Oct 09 PHP
php使用imagick模块实现图片缩放、裁剪、压缩示例
Apr 17 PHP
简单的php新闻发布系统教程
May 09 PHP
php实现读取手机客户端浏览器的类
Jan 09 PHP
PHP中静态变量的使用方法实例分析
Dec 01 PHP
如何用PHP做到页面注册审核
Mar 02 PHP
ThinkPHP模板标签eq if 中区分0,null,false的方法
Mar 24 PHP
php file_get_contents取文件中数组元素的方法
Apr 01 PHP
php批量修改表结构实例
May 24 PHP
ThinkPHP框架实现导出excel数据的方法示例【基于PHPExcel】
May 12 PHP
php+lottery.js实现九宫格抽奖功能
Jul 21 PHP
php操作redis命令及代码实例大全
Nov 19 PHP
一些php技巧与注意事项分析
Feb 03 #PHP
PHP数组对比函数,存在交集则返回真,否则返回假
Feb 03 #PHP
用PHP读取和编写XML DOM的实现代码
Feb 03 #PHP
javascript,php获取函数参数对象的代码
Feb 03 #PHP
php下将多个数组合并成一个数组的方法与实例代码
Feb 03 #PHP
PHP操作数组相关函数
Feb 03 #PHP
php做下载文件的实现代码及文件名中乱码解决方法
Feb 03 #PHP
You might like
Centos 6.5下PHP 5.3安装ffmpeg扩展的步骤详解
2017/03/02 PHP
从ThinkPHP3.2.3过渡到ThinkPHP5.0学习笔记图文详解
2019/04/03 PHP
javascript编程起步(第二课)
2007/02/27 Javascript
为jquery.ui.dialog 增加“自动记住关闭时的位置”的功能
2009/11/24 Javascript
JS获取select的value和text值的简单实例
2014/02/26 Javascript
WordPress中鼠标悬停显示和隐藏评论及引用按钮的实现
2016/01/12 Javascript
Javascript缓存API
2016/06/14 Javascript
基于JavaScript实现拖动滑块效果
2017/02/16 Javascript
Google 爬虫如何抓取 JavaScript 的内容
2017/04/07 Javascript
js每隔两秒输出数组中的一项(实例)
2017/05/28 Javascript
JavaScript实现单英文金山打字通
2020/07/24 Javascript
用VsCode编辑TypeScript的实现方法
2020/05/07 Javascript
Element Notification通知的实现示例
2020/07/27 Javascript
实例讲解Python中global语句下全局变量的值的修改
2016/06/16 Python
python 读写、创建 文件的方法(必看)
2016/09/12 Python
python获取点击的坐标画图形的方法
2019/07/09 Python
python实现批量修改服务器密码的方法
2019/08/13 Python
wxpython多线程防假死与线程间传递消息实例详解
2019/12/13 Python
python使用pyecharts库画地图数据可视化的实现
2020/03/25 Python
Python使用monkey.patch_all()解决协程阻塞问题
2020/04/15 Python
什么是Python中的匿名函数
2020/06/02 Python
python利用pytesseract 实现本地识别图片文字
2020/12/14 Python
Roxy荷兰官方网站:冲浪、滑雪板、服装和配件
2019/10/22 全球购物
端口镜像是怎么实现的
2014/03/25 面试题
最新计算机专业自荐信
2013/10/16 职场文书
教育合作协议范本
2014/10/17 职场文书
金榜题名主持词
2015/07/02 职场文书
小学作文指导之如何写人?
2019/07/08 职场文书
2019西餐厅创业计划书范文!
2019/07/12 职场文书
CSS3实现模糊背景的三种效果示例
2021/03/30 HTML / CSS
浅谈MySQL 亿级数据分页的优化
2021/06/15 MySQL
Go语言基础知识点介绍
2021/07/04 Golang
python获取对象信息的实例详解
2021/07/07 Python
新手初学Java List 接口
2021/07/07 Java/Android
Python集合set()使用的方法详解
2022/03/18 Python
Node.js实现爬取网站图片的示例代码
2022/04/04 NodeJs